Mental / Emotional Issues
What is the proper way to address mental / emotional stability issues as an attorney? Is the ethical answer to take a leave of absence until you're recovered? Or just keep trucking along?

Re: Mental / Emotional Issues
It would depend on how much the issues are affecting your work. It would be much better to take a leave voluntarily than to screw something up badly and risk getting fired/losing your license. Get treatment, and good luck. (Also ask your provider what they think?)
